【问题标题】:participants tied with Organization Hyperledger Composer参与者与组织 Hyperledger Composer 相关联
【发布时间】:2018-03-17 00:20:45
【问题描述】:

当我们定义模型时,我想了解参与者与组织的关系。 例如,如果我有3 participants(Grower, Shipper, Trader) 并且拥有3 organization(OrgGrower,OrgShipper, OrgTrader) 的网络 然后将添加参与者如何在参与者和组织之间映射一对一的关系。 我想通过网站完成所有这些,并授予管理员访问权限以仅添加参与者,但也想 拥有可以访问所有组织的超级管理员。这可以通过 Hyperledger composer 实现吗

【问题讨论】:

    标签: hyperledger-fabric hyperledger hyperledger-composer


    【解决方案1】:

    在 Rocket Chat 上回复了相同的帖子:

    在 Composer 中,Participant 只是一个数据项,特别是 Participant Registry 中的一个对象。在向该参与者颁发并绑定一个身份之前,参与者不能访问 Fabric 上的业务网络。身份由属于某个组织的 CA 生成。拥有身份的用户(管理员)如果拥有 ACL 访问权限,则可以创建参与者,但只有在 CA 中具有特定权限的身份才能发布身份。该文档更详细地描述了参与者和身份:https://hyperledger.github.io/composer//managing/participantsandidentities 我不知道 CA 是否可以“交叉认证”以允许您的超级管理员为 3 个 CA(组织)颁发身份。有一个#fabric-ca 频道应该能够回答这个问题。

    【讨论】:

    • 您好,这不是原始发帖人问题的一部分,但是,如果身份是由属于某个组织的 CA 颁发的,那么来自单独组织的颁发者可以使用该 CA 为该参与者颁发最终身份吗?如果是这样的话,可以根据组织标准限制参与者身份的发布。
    猜你喜欢
    • 2023-03-10
    • 1970-01-01
    • 2019-01-27
    • 2018-12-14
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多